Small edge lit gift for a little girl

Post by Xxray »

I etched the butterfly profile design into the plexi and from there it was pretty simple to use paint pens to fill in the etches. Is only about 4" square, made it to fit in the slot of this little plastic LED base. I think it looks better unlit, when its lit it highlights the flaws but hey, I doubt if a little girl is going to care much about that.

Craft people should not underrate plexi+paint pens ,,, Alot of folks would simply slap a vinyl sticker on and call it good, using paint gives it that hand made look and feel, it will never be perfect.

Main thing to watch out for is paint blobbing out of the pen, can easily happen with too much pressure.
